Hydrocinnamic Acid, more formally known as 3-Phenylpropionic Acid, stands as a cornerstone in modern organic synthesis. Its chemical formula, C9H10O2, belies its substantial utility as a precursor and intermediate in the creation of a vast array of complex organic molecules. This compound's unique structure, featuring a phenyl ring attached to a propionic acid backbone, provides a reactive platform that chemists leverage for diverse synthetic endeavors.

The primary role of Hydrocinnamic Acid in the chemical industry is as a chemical synthesis intermediate. Its carboxylic acid functional group readily participates in esterification, amidation, and other crucial reactions, making it invaluable in the production pipelines for pharmaceuticals. Many active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) and drug intermediates rely on the structural integrity and reactivity offered by compounds like Hydrocinnamic Acid.

Beyond pharmaceuticals, the compound is a critical component in the agrochemical sector. It serves as a building block for synthesizing various pesticides and plant growth regulators. These applications are vital for enhancing crop yields and protecting agricultural output, contributing significantly to global food security. The development of new and more effective agricultural chemicals often starts with the careful selection of versatile intermediates like 3-Phenylpropionic Acid.

The versatility extends to the realm of specialty chemicals, where Hydrocinnamic Acid is employed in the creation of fragrances, flavors, and advanced materials. Its aromatic nature contributes pleasant scents, making it a component in certain perfumery applications, and its derivatives can be used to impart specific characteristics to polymers and resins.
